Arla to Buy FriesLand Foods Fresh Nijkerk

April 1st, 2009

In the Netherlands, Arla Foods is going to be buying up all the shares in FriesLand Foods Fresh Nijkerk. This deal will include the company’s fresh dairy business including its brands of yoghurt. Their Friesche Vlag brand will be used only in the Netherlands and they have signed a ten year agreement on that. Though they are still awaiting approval by the European Commission, it looks as though things will be up and running in the new mode from the next quarter.

The brands go from fruit flavoured yoghurt to buttermilk to natural as well as quark yoghurt to porridge and custard. The Friesche Vlag brand is also used for many dairy products and they make brands for some supermarkets. It looks like it is setting itself up for a great run in Europe.
